Ticket: Validator plugin vault locked (Project Cribwork)

Priority: high. The plugin-signing vault for the data-validator framework locked after the Thursday rotation failed midway. Release manager impact: can't sign the new schema validators, blocking the cut. Ops confirmed the vault state is healthy; only the lock tripped. No data loss. Manual unlock is approved for this release only — log the unlock in the release notes. Unlock the vault with the recovery passphrase below.

vault phrase of bagaf-kajeg = jorath-feniel-briir-siliel-ralix

Pagewarden collapses duplicate on-call alerts within a rolling window before paging. Security-relevant points: dedup keys are derived from alert fingerprints, not raw payloads; suppressed alerts are still logged to the audit stream; the suppression window is bounded to prevent indefinite silencing of repeated incidents. If the deduplicator is down, alerts pass through unfiltered — noisy but safe. Do not widen the window without review, as it increases the blind spot for repeated intrusion signals. Deployed values are as follows.

service settings:
PRAIX_LOG_LEVEL=error
PRAIX_METRICS_HOST=metrics.praix.qorvelcorp.corp
PRAIX_POOL_SIZE=16

## Deployment

The PointsKeeper ledger service deploys from the main branch via the standard Fernway pipeline. Each release runs the balance-reconciliation check before traffic is shifted; a failed check blocks promotion automatically. New team members should not edit production settings directly — changes go through the config repo. The values currently applied in production are listed below.

deployment values, yahag-tawef:
ZORWYN_HOST=zorwyn.tolvaqlabs.internal
ZORWYN_PORT=9300

Ticket: Staging env misconfigured for Siftgate bloom filter

The bloom layer in front of the Pellet KV store is rejecting all lookups in staging because the env file was copied from the dev template without credentials. False-positive tuning values are fine; only the auth line is missing. To unblock the weekly demo, the Pellet admission secret must be set on the following line.

env line for yaguf-fajop: LEDGER_TOKEN13=fb08984397349